DispatchBot Vs. Swoop Talent

DispatchBot: DispatchBot provides hosted software-as-a-service (SAAS) solutions for transportation providers. We specialize in non-emergency medical transportation (NEMT) dispatching software. Our software is web-based and includes a mobile application for drivers in the field to have access to their manifests.

Who is more expensive? DispatchBot or Swoop?

The real total cost of ownership (TCO) of Truck Dispatch software includes the software license, subscription fees, software training, customizations, hardware (if needed), maintenance and support and other related services. When calculating the TCO, it's important to add all of these ”hidden costs” as well. We prepared a TCO (Total Cost) calculator for DispatchBot and Swoop.

DispatchBot price starts at $25 per vehicle/month , On a scale between 1 to 10 DispatchBot is rated 4, which is lower than the average cost of Truck Dispatch software. Swoop price starts at $349 per user/month , When comparing Swoop to its competitors, the software is rated 6 - similar to the average Truck Dispatch software cost.

Bottom line: Swoop is more expensive than DispatchBot.

DispatchBot is a cloud-based transport and distribution solution. It offers its clients an automated dispatch system that calculates the most viable routes to take as well as computer-aided dispatch.
